Haitian Shrimp
Ingredients
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ter ⓘ
- 2 tablespoons olive oil ⓘ
- 3 cloves garlic, minced ⓘ
- 1 small rib celery, finely chopped ⓘ
- 1 small carrot, finely chopped ⓘ
- 1/2 small onion, finely chopped ⓘ
- 2 large ripe tomatoes, peeled, seeded, and chopped ⓘ
- 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per ⓘ
- 1/2 small bunch flatleaf parsley, leaves only, finely chopped ⓘ
- 1/2 teaspoon sugar ⓘ
- 1/2 teaspoon salt ⓘ
- 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per ⓘ
- 2 pounds medium raw shrimp, peeled and deveined ⓘ
- 1/4 cup white wine ⓘ
Instructions
- In a large skillet, heat the butter and the olive oil over low heat.
- Add the garlic, celery, carrot,
- onion, tomatoes, cayenne, half of the parsley, sugar, salt, and black pepper.
- Cover the pan and raise the heat to mediumlow.
- Simmer the mixture for about 5 minutes, until the vegetables are tender.
- Add the shrimp, cover the pan and cook for 3 minutes.
- Add the wine and the remaining parsley and stir until the liquid comes to a bare simmer.
- Remove from the heat and serve, accompanied by white or yellow rice.
